Every company should have a unique corporate identity, which is defined as corporate design, corporate communication and corporate behavior. Part of the company design aspect of corporate identity is embodied by a company logo, which is a graphical symbol that represents the company.

A lot of small business owners do not consider how important a corporate logo is to their brand’s identity. Many logos you see evidently had little effort put into their creation, which reflects badly on the company.

This is understandable as not every business owner is able to design their own logo, so they have to pay someone to come up with a logo for their business if they want one that looks good. Having a custom logo designed use to mean spending many thousands of dollars with a logo design firm to design they might like. Now, any company can afford graphic design logos.

Some would argue you get what you pay for when it comes to cheap logos. If you pay less than $200 for a logo design, can you get a logo of decent quality? The answer is yes, you can. These designs fit the needs of the average entrepreneur quite well.

Many small businesses need to use a fax machine regularly. However, fax machines tend to be pricey, because they need a dedicated phone line. Fortunately, there is a solution to this issue.

Web faxing eliminates the problem of needing a costly dedicated telephone line. With a online faxing provider, you receive a dedicated fax number that does not require you to have a dedicated telephone line. All you need is the ability to be online, and the fax company takes care of everything else.
